Summary:

Zip code 95965 in Oroville, California, is served by 12 public schools spanning grades K-12, including traditional elementary, middle, and high schools as well as several alternative and charter programs, all operating within a high-need community.

Among these schools, STREAM Charter stands out as the highest-performing traditional school, ranking in the 55th percentile statewide and showing strong improvement, while also spending the least per student. Other notable schools include Poplar Avenue Elementary with an excellent chronic absenteeism rate of only 7.2%, and the alternative school Hearthstone, which reports a graduation rate above 82%. However, the area faces significant academic challenges, with average test scores in English and math below state averages, and some schools like Sierra Avenue Elementary and Prospect High (Continuation) struggling with very low rankings or high dropout rates.

Key insights for parents include a noticeable drop in math performance in middle school grades across multiple schools, and significant variation even between schools in the same Thermalito Union Elementary district. The data suggests that higher per-student spending does not always correlate with better outcomes, and that alternative schools can provide successful pathways for some students. Families should look closely at individual school performance data, particularly in core subjects and attendance rates, as experiences can differ greatly from one school to the next in this zip code.
